OBJECTIVE: To investigate inhibitory activities of a homogenous anti-human epidermal growth factor receptor 2 (HER2)-antibody drug conjugate (ADC) on the proliferation of nine tumor cell lines with different levels of HER2 expressions, and its activities on the tumor growth of five xenograft mouse models. METHODS: The HER2 expression levels of BT-474, Calu-3, MCF-7, MDA-MB-231, MDA-MB-468, SK-BR-3, SK-OV-3, HCC1954, NCI-N87 tumor cell lines were measured using QIFI KIT. For the in vitro anti-proliferation assay, serial diluted anti-HER2-ADC, ado-trastuzumab emtansine, AS269, pAF-AS269 and paclitaxel were added to the seeded cells, and after 72 or 96 hours of incubation, the cell proliferation was analyzed. For the in vivo activity, 5-6 weeks old mice were inoculated with four HER2 positive tumor cell lines HCC1954, BT-474, SK-OV-3, NCI-N87 or one HER2 negative tumor cell line MDA-MB-468. Different amounts of anti-HER2-ADC, ado-trastuzumab emtansine, trastuzumab, paclitaxel and phosphate buffered saline control were injected after the tumor volume reached a certain size, then the tumor growth inhibition was analyzed. RESULTS: The expression levels of the six high HER2-expression cell lines SK-OV-3, NCI-N87, SK-BR-3, Calu-3, HCC1954, BT-474 were between 430 000 to 800 000 receptors per cell, which were 50 times higher than those of the other three low HER2 expression tumor cell lines MDA-MB-231, MCF-7, MDA-MB-468. Anti-HER2-ADC had inhibition effects on cell lines with high level of HER2 expression in the in vitro anti-proliferation assay. The half maximal inhibitory concentrations of anti-HER2-ADC on SK-OV-3, NCI-N87, SK-BR-3, Calu-3, HCC1954, BT-474 tumor cell lines were 46 pmol/L, 17 pmol/L, 17 pmol/L, 161 pmol/L, 125 pmol/L, 50 pmol/L, respectively. Anti-HER2-ADC had a dose dependent antitumor activity in vivo in all the HER2 positive xenograft mouse models. In NCI-N87 xenograft tumor model, the same dose of anti-HER2-ADC showed better anti-tumor activity compared with trastuzumab and ado-trastuzumab emtansine, and its relative tumor proliferation rates were about 1/30 to 1/20 of the two. In HCC1954 xenograft tumor model, the complete regression of the tumor was observed. As expected, anti-HER2-ADC had no tumor inhibitory effects on MDA-MB-468 xenograft models with low HER2 expression. The antitumor activities of anti-HER2-ADC in HER2 positive xenograft tumor models were the same as or better than the activities of ado-trastuzumab emtansine. CONCLUSION: The homogenous site-specific anti-HER2-ADC obtained using unnatural amino acid technology can inhibit the growth of high HER2-expression tumor cells with high potency both in vivo and in vitro.

The effect of atmosphere turbulence on light's spatial structure compromises the information capacity of photons carrying the Orbital Angular Momentum (OAM) in free-space optical (FSO) communications. In this paper, we study two aberration correction methods to mitigate this effect. The first one is the Shack-Hartmann wavefront correction method, which is based on the Zernike polynomials, and the second is a phase correction method specific to OAM states. Our numerical results show that the phase correction method for OAM states outperforms the Shark-Hartmann wavefront correction method, although both methods improve significantly purity of a single OAM state and the channel capacities of FSO communication link. At the same time, our experimental results show that the values of participation functions go down at the phase correction method for OAM states, i.e., the correction method ameliorates effectively the bad effect of atmosphere turbulence.

In this work we explore the quantum correlation quantified by trace distance discord as a measure to analyze the quantum critical behaviors in the Ising-XXZ diamond structure at finite temperatures. It is found that the first-order derivative of the trace distance discord exhibits a maximum around the critical point at finite temperatures. By analyzing the finite-temperature scaling behavior, we show that such a quantum correlation can detect exactly the quantum phase transitions from the entan-gled state in ferrimagnetic phase to an unentangled state in ferrimagnetic phase or to an unentangled state in ferromagnetic phase. The results also indicate that the above two kinds of transitions can be distinguished by the different finite-temperature scaling behaviors. Moreover, we find that the trace distance discord, in contrast to other typical quantum correlations (e.g., concurrence, quantum discord and Hellinger distance), may be more reliable to exactly spotlight the critical points of this model at finite temperatures under certain situations.

OBJECTIVE: To observe the effects of chemotherapy combined with Chinese herbal medicine (Spleen-Kidney tonifying) in treating advanced tumor patients and on immune parameters. METHODS: One hundred and one advanced tumor patients were randomly divided into the treated group (54 patients) treated by Chinese medicine combined with chemotherapy, and the control group (47 patients) treated by chemotherapy alone. After being treated for 8 weeks (2 treatment courses), the changes of tumor size, body weight, Karnofsky scores, immunologic parameters, peripheral blood cells, as well as the toxic and side-effects were also studied. RESULTS: Improvement of various degree was obtained on the immunologic parameters such as CD3, CD4, CD4/CD8, NK cells, and the quality of life, as Karnofsky score in the treated group, in comparing with those in the control group the difference was significant (P < 0.05, P < 0.01). But on behalf of the toxic and side-effects in advanced patients, there was no significant difference between the two groups. CONCLUSION: Chemotherapy combined with Chinese Spleen-Kidney tonifying drugs could improve the immunologic functions in the advanced tumor patients.

OBJECTIVES: Scatter factor, also known as hepatocyte growth factor (SF/HGF), is a polypeptide growth factor with a number of biologic activities, including cell scattering, stimulation of cell motility, mitogenesis, morphogenesis, angiogenesis, and cellular invasiveness, it is thought to be important in the growth and spread of several carcinomas. We assessed whether preoperative plasma levels of HGF and carcinoembryonic antigen (CEA) can enhance the accuracy of standard models for predicting pathologic features and clinical outcomes. PATIENTS AND METHODS: The study comprised 45 consecutive patients treated with surgery for clinically localized non-small-cell lung cancer. HGF and CEA were measured using the commercially available immunoassay. Multivariate logistic regression was used to assess the relationship between plasma HGF/CEA and pathologic features. Multivariate Cox regression was used to predict disease recurrence. RESULTS: Patients with lung squamous cell cancer (SCC) more frequently had higher plasma HGF, whereas CEA levels were significantly elevated in patients with non-SCC histology. Preoperative plasma HGF and CEA levels were not the independent predictors of overall survival. CONCLUSIONS: Preoperative plasma levels of HGF and CEA are not the independent predictors of non-small lung cancer disease recurrence and metastasis after surgery; HGF is a predictor of lung squamous cell cancer. Use of HGF may help in therapeutic decision-making and estimate the histological type of NSCLC.

In the present study, the effects of tanshinone IIA (TSN) on the prevention of left ventricular hypertrophy (LVH) and apoptotic processes were observed in spontaneously hypertensive rats (SHRs). A total of 18 SHRs (age, 8 weeks) were randomly divided into three groups. The SHRs in the control group (group S8) were sacrificed at week 8 of the experiment. The SHRs in the treatment group (group D18) and the placebo group (group S18) were injected with TSN and distilled water (1 ml/kg body weight/day), respectively, for 10 weeks, commencing at week 8, and were subsequently sacrificed at week 18. The systolic blood pressure (SBP) and left ventricular mass index (LVMI) were determined. Using hematoxylin and eosin and van Gieson staining, together with immunohistological methods, cardiomyocyte size and diameter, collagen volume fraction (CVF) and perivascular circumferential area (PVCA) were measured. Evaluation of Bcl-2, Bax and p53 expression levels for apoptosis analysis was performed using western blotting. It was observed that the SBP, LVMI, cardiomyocyte size and diameter, CVF, PCVA and cardiomyocyte apoptosis index (Bax and p53 expression) were increased significantly in group S18 compared with group S8. However, Bcl-2 expression levels were decreased in group S18 compared with group S8. The administration of TSN in group D18 resulted in higher Bcl-2 expression levels and significantly decreased LVMI, cardiomyocyte size and diameter, CVF, PCVA, Bax and p53 expression levels compared with group S18. LVH and apoptosis of the cardiac tissues increased with the increasing age of the SHRs. TSN may inhibit the development of LVH and decrease the level of apoptosis in SHRs, possibly via the upregulation of Bcl-2 and the downregulation of Bax and p53 expression.
